Frequently Asked Questions

Do Chile citizens need a visa to visit Bosnia and Herzegovina?

No, Chile citizens do not need a visa to visit Bosnia and Herzegovina. You can enter Bosnia and Herzegovina with just your valid Chile passport.

You can stay for up to 90 days for tourism, business, or transit purposes.

What documents do I need to travel from Chile to Bosnia and Herzegovina?

Essential documents for travel from Chile to Bosnia and Herzegovina:

  • Valid Chile passport with at least 3-6 months validity
  • At least 2 blank pages in your passport for stamps
  • Proof of accommodation (hotel booking or invitation letter)
  • Return or onward travel ticket
  • Proof of sufficient funds for your stay
  • Travel insurance (recommended or required)
